Transaction 251fec8952cb8a93052c80b8bd9e36c878040dddaa0ae633032d0a267cae7e79

1 Input
2 Outputs
  • 251fec8952cb8a93052c80b8bd9e36c878040dddaa0ae633032d0a267cae7e79:0
  • value  499976875
    address  1HdyQf8DQPmkWQDsEtcSfMUqzxffJ772b3
  • 251fec8952cb8a93052c80b8bd9e36c878040dddaa0ae633032d0a267cae7e79:1
  • value  8930925840
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v